Liverpool 2023/24 Premier League Bilan de la saison Liverpool, pour sa dernière saison sous la direction de l'Allemand Jürgen Klopp, a atteint son objectif initial d'avant-saison, à savoir se qualifier une nouvelle fois pour la Ligue des champions. Bien que l'on ait parlé d'un quadruplé dès le mois de mars, les Reds ont terminé la saison en remportant la Coupe EFL, ce qui a permis à Klopp de partir. Ils ont quitté l'Europa League au stade des quarts de finale, tout comme la FA Cup, et ont terminé à la troisième place de l'EPL. Quel a été le bilan de cette saison pour Liverpool ? Aston Villa 2023/24 Premier League Bilan de la saison Aston Villa, pour sa première saison complète sous la direction d'Unai Emery, a vu son incroyable évolution se poursuivre en s'assurant un retour en Ligue des champions après plus de 40 ans. Dans le même temps, le tacticien espagnol a mené le club jusqu'en demi-finale de l'Europa League, prouvant une fois de plus à quel point il est adapté aux succès continentaux. La transformation de l'équipe de Birmingham a été telle que Villa s'est retrouvé dans la course au titre à la fin de l'année 2023, qualifié de "cheval noir" après avoir remporté plusieurs matches consécutifs à domicile contre des prétendants au titre, Arsenal et Manchester City. The History of the English Premier League Match Balls The English Premier League has seen numerous changes and developments since its inception in 1992. One of the most fascinating aspects of the league’s evolution is the history of its match balls. This article explores the journey of the Premier League balls, from their early designs to the sophisticated technology used in the modern era. Early Years: The Mitre Era (1992-2000) When the Premier League was founded in 1992, Mitre was the official ball supplier. Manchester City 2023/24 Premier League Season Review It is safe to say that this season’s Premier League went according to plan for Manchester City. They have secured a 4th consecutive title, seeing off the threat of Arsenal with a win on the final day, and achieved what no other team has done before. Meanwhile, Pep Guardiola won the Manager of the Season award and Phil Foden took home the award for Player of the Season. A 4th Manager Leaves We now know that, after Jürgen Klopp, David Moyes and Roberto De Zerbi, there is one more manager who has left a Premier League team: Chelsea’s Mauricio Pochettino. He ends his association with the Blues by mutual consent after just one season, having guided his team to a European spot at the end of 2023-24.
